In 1919, the diary of a parliamentary cavalry officer written on an interleaved copy of william lilly's merlini anglici ephemeris was exhibited at the society of antiquaries of newcastle upon tyne. It was discovered to be that of major john sanderson for the year 1648, an officer in colonel robert lilburne's regiment of horse.
